Are people in Eagle Mountain older or younger than people in Oakley?
- The Median Age in Eagle Mountain is 14.7 years younger than in Oakley.

Are housing costs cheaper in Eagle Mountain or Oakley?
- Eagle Mountain housing costs are 24.8% less expensive than Oakley hous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Eagle Mountain or Oakley?
- The average commute for residents of Eagle Mountain is 6.5 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Oakley.
